About Us

Shawbrook is a specialist UK lending and savings bank founded in 2011 to serve the needs of SMEs and individuals in the UK with a range of lending and saving products.

We differentiate ourselves by concentrating on markets where our specialist knowledge and personalised approach to underwriting offer us a competitive advantage. This supports attractive, stable returns and sustainable growth, and also benefits businesses and consumers in parts of the market which continue to be poorly served by traditional high street banks. Fundamental to our success is a relationship focus which puts the interests of our customers and business partners at the heart of everything we do, built on a culture which stresses the use of our experience and judgement to make decisions that balance risk, return and customer needs.

Job Description

We're currently recruiting for a a senior member of the IT Data Team in Brentwood. You will be involved in the design and delivery of high quality systems and processes. The role holder will work on a project-by-project basis, developing IT solutions across a range of systems and applications as designated. You will gain great exposure to IT Porjects and the wider bank, managing key stakeholders.

Duties & Responsibilities

- Keep up-to-date with new technologies and industry standards; seek self-development and opportunities to progress, learn new skills and maintain high quality work

- Proficient in data analysis, defect identification and resolution

- Support IT Data Manager and Head of IT to liaison with business colleagues in the areas of specification, estimation and testing of development deliverables

- Responding to allocated tickets, providing a timely and appropriate response to problems and issues across a broad range of software projects

- Resolve all development tasks within the specified timeframe, reporting to the IT Data Manager if the timescale cannot be met

- Effectively use the feedback from business users to keep the team connected to any issues before they become bigger problems. Feed and translate the feedback into development tasks to improve quality of the deliverables

- Where necessary act as a mentor for junior colleagues

- Contribute to the continuous development of the team

- Display great team spirit and loyalty towards colleagues whilst maintaining a high performance level

- Documentation creation and management

- Identifies and investigates data quality/integrity problems, determines impact and provides solutions to problems

- Ensure security and risk are the fundamental foundations for design, decision and delivery

- Deputise for the IT Data Manager when required

The Individual

Qualifications/Certification

- Minimum of a Bachelor's degree OR a minimum of 5 years of experience and/or training in the technical Business Intelligence field, or equivalent combination of education and experience

- Microsoft qualifications advantageous but not essential

Experience (type & level)

- Minimum of 5 years of recent experience in querying and analysing data sources in a Microsoft environment to understand the data and determine logic for data transformations

- Minimum of 5 years recent relevant technical experience with Microsoft data integration tools and/or EDW design and development in a Microsoft environment

- ITIL or similar - working within Change & Incident frameworks

- Ticket management

- Working with financial services or other regulated environment - preferred but not essential

- Data transformation from external sources

Technical

- SQL Server 2008R2/2012/2016

- T-SQL

- SSIS

- SSRS

- Performance tuning & best practises

- Conceptual, logical and physical data modelling

- OLAP database design and theory

- OLTP database design and theory

- Understanding of Infrastructure Architecture

- Able to interact with technical experts in other areas of IT to ensure that underlying architecture is correct and delivered

- Understanding of BI concepts and theory.
